Arsenal’s poor run of form continued on Wednesday evening in the UEFA Champions League as their 1-0 defeat in Italy to Inter Milan now means that the Gunners have now only won once in six away games in all competitions. In contrast, the Nerazzuris were able to stretch their unbeaten run to nine matches in all competitions.
Arsenal were facing a much different Inter Milan as the Blue half of Milan prepared for their Serie A clash at the weekend against league leaders Napoli. However, it didn’t stop them from threatening Arsenal as Denzel Dumfries’ outside-the-boot effort came back off the woodwork just two minutes in.
Minutes later, Turkish midfielder, Hakan Çalhanoğlu flashed an effort just wide from distance throwing Arsenal on the back foot. When Arsenal grew into the game, their first first first half aeffort was from Bukayo Saka but it was comfortably gathered by Yann Sommer.
Just as things were going smoothly, Arsenal went from having a penalty shout to conceding a penalty as Mikel Merino was penalized for handball. Hakan Çalhanoğlu stepped up and scored his 19th successive spot-kick as the hosts led into the break.
Gabriel Martinelli led Arsenal’s push for an early second-half equalizer early, but his left-footed shot only struck the side-netting while Denzel Dumfries cleared off the line from Saka’s corner moments later.
German forward Kai Havertz could have equalized when he unleashed a curler that looked destined for the top corner, but Inter goalkeeper Yann Sommer tipped it over.
Despite the second half dominance from the Gunners Inter Milan stood resolute for a UCL clean sheet that was further helped by a poor finishing from Arsenal. Arsenal have now lost their unbeaten start while Inter maintained their impressive unbeaten start to the league phase with three wins and a draw.
While Inter Milan face Napoli in the Serie A next, Arsenal will hope to bounce back with a Premier League game at Chelsea.
